#d30718 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d30718 is composed of 82.7% red, 2.7%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 42.7%. #d30718 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e30 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#d30718 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d30718 has RGB values of R:211, G:7,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.89,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13829912.

Shades and Tints of #d30718
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#feeef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d30718
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c6c is the less saturated color, while #d30718 is the most saturated one.
